ABSTRACT:
Method in branching off a tube (10) wherein an oval aperture (11) is made in the tube wall and a tube element (12) having a flange (13) at one end thereof, is inserted through the oval aperture from the outside of the tube. The flange is pressed against the inside surface of the tube by means of a ring (15) provided on the tube element, which is engaged with the outside surface of the tube and is fixedly secured to the tube element, a sealing ring being located between said flange on the tube element and the inside surface of the tube.
